Cuba's Mariel boatlift

Cuba's Mariel boatlift

In April 1980, thousands of Cubans tried to escape the country by claiming asylum at the Peruvian embassy in Havana.

In response, Cuban President Fidel Castro opened the port of Mariel to anyone who wanted to leave, including criminals. From April until October more than 100,000 Cubans left for the US. Mirta Ojito was one of them. She spoke to Simon Watts in 2011.
